World of Demons is Going Offline, Will Stop Being Available on January 18

Those who already have World of Demons installed can only play the game until February 1.

PlatinumGames has announced that it will be ending support for its Apple Arcade-exclusive hack-and-slash action game World of Demons on January 18. After the date, the game will no longer be available for download. The announcement also states that the game will only be playable for those that already have the game installed for an additional two weeks before going offline on February 1.

World of Demons puts players in the shoes of samurai taking on various yokai inspired by Japanese mythology. Along with hack-and-slash gameplay, the title also allows players to summon their own yokai minions in battle. Throughout their battles against yokai in the game, players will eventually come face-to-face with the primary antagonist, Shuten Doji.

Originally announced as a live service title that would get a host of updates bringing balance changes and new content to the game, World of Demons is another example of PlatinumGames’ lack of success in the live service market. Made by the developers behind Nier: Automata, World of Demons was originally conceptualised as featuring in-app purchases. Its release on Apple Arcade likely dashed those plans, however.
